Operation
Power
Press the front panel POWER switch to apply power. Adjust
the volume to the appropriate level using the amplifier volume
control.
To Select a Band
Press the button marked BAND. The current band appears on
the display: FM1, FM2, FM3, AM1 or AM2.
You can preset up to six stations on each band for a total of 30
preset stations (18 FM and 12 AM).
To Tune a Station
Press the UP or DOWN buttons.
To Preset Stations
1. Select a band and tune the first desired station.
2. Press one of the “M” buttons; for example, M1 (The preset
number appears on the display as CH1).
3. Continue pressing the “M” button until the program material
from the speaker stops for a second and then resumes.
This indicates that the preset is stored.
4. Tune the next station and repeat Steps 2 & 3 for the 2
nd
through 6th preset.
To Scan Preset Stations
1. Select a band. The first preset station (CH1) will appear on
the display.
2. Press the button marked MSCAN. Each preset station will
play for 5 seconds in turn while scanning.
3. To stop the scanning, press the “MSCAN” button again.
Program Selection
Use the AUX/TUNER button to select program from the tuner or
aux source. Push in for Aux program. Push out for Tuner pro-
gram
